Shia LaBeouf in Hot Water with Brad Pitt for Skipping Showers on Fury Set

Shia LaBeouf’s commitment to his role in the movie Fury has stirred up some controversy, particularly with his co-star Brad Pitt, as he opted out of showering to immerse himself into character.

Instead of following the conventional route, Shia LaBeouf, known for his role in Transformers, chose to adopt the Method acting technique for the Second World War drama, leaving many perplexed on set.

A source revealed to The Mail on Sunday that Shia’s extreme dedication led him down a peculiar path, causing disruptions during filming.

He went as far as extracting one of his own teeth early on and refrained from bathing for an extended period to grasp the essence of life in the trenches.

Brad Pitt reportedly confronted Shia regarding his unorthodox methods, expressing concerns about his behavior amidst the production of the film.

Despite multiple warnings from various individuals on set, including Brad Pitt and director David Ayer, Shia remained steadfast in his approach, distancing himself from the rest of the cast by relocating to a modest bed-and-breakfast accommodation.

The filming of the £50 million project took place in Oxfordshire, showcasing the lengths actors like Shia LaBeouf go to in order to embody their characters authentically.
